Title |
Egan Family Photo Circa 1916 |
Description |
Matte black photograph of (from left to right) Elizabeth Isabel Egan (age 9), Charles Egan (age 54), Elizabeth McCort Egan, Lieutenant Harold Egan. This photo was taken before Lieutenant Egan's departure for the First World War. All are looking at the camera in this full body photo, and while the three on the left are wearing winter clothes, Lieutenant Egan is wearing a uniform. They are standing on the sidewalk in front of the front steps of the Egan home in Petrolia. It is winter. In an associated note, the photo is dated circa 1916. This also mentions that Lieutenant Egan was part of the Canadian Expeditionary Force, and that his train left from London Ont. There is a finding aid in 4B Box 33, Egan (Charles) |
